Returns annual gross earnings and hourly labour costs per country, in national currency or euro and in purchasing power standards, and never blends the two. The separation is the point: forty-five thousand euro in one country and twenty-two thousand in another is a factor of two nominally and much less in purchasing power, and which figure is correct depends entirely on the question.
